Best 67855 Kansas Public Preschools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 240 students in 67855, KS.
The top-ranked public preschool in 67855, KS is Stanton County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school in zipcode 67855 have an average math proficiency score of 32% (versus the Kansas public pre school average of 40%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 40% statewide average). Pre schools in 67855, KS have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Kansas public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 38%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is more than the Kansas public preschool average of 36% (majority Hispanic).
